Description: The beautiful equation, or the Euler equation of complex analysis, this bit of mathematics enjoys accolades across geeky disciplines. Swiss mathematician Leonhard Euler first wrote the equality, which links together geometry, algebra, and five of the most essential symbols in math -- 0, 1, i, pi and e -- that are essential tools in scientific work. Theoretical physicist Richard Feynman was a huge fan and called it a "jewel" and a “remarkable” formula. Fans today refer to it as “the most beautiful equation."

Description: In the general theory of relativity, the Einstein field equations relate the geometry of spacetime to the distribution of matter within it.
